About us Meridian Health & Social Care are a domiciliary care company in Burnley who provide a range of care and support services for our service users. We strive to offer support and guidance to the people we care for, providing them with the confidence and resources to live a healthy, safe, happy life in their own homes. Responsibilities
As a care worker, your responsibilities may include supporting personal care needs, preparing meals, and taking part in a wide range of special interests and activities that support health and wellbeing such as gardening, shopping trips and social occasions. No two days will be the same! Our service users are individuals, and all deserve to be treated as such.
